what is the number one father-daughter dance song?


The number one father-daughter dance song is often considered to be "Butterfly Kisses" by Bob Carlisle, due to its emotional lyrics about a father's love and its popularity at weddings. However, rankings can vary based on sources and personal preferences.

father daughter wedding dance


The father-daughter wedding dance is a cherished tradition in many English-speaking cultures, particularly in Western weddings, where the bride shares a slow dance with her father. This moment symbolizes the father's love, support, and blessing as his daughter begins her married life. It typically follows the newlyweds' first dance and serves as an emotional highlight of the reception.

Common practices include selecting a sentimental song, such as "My Girl" by The Temptations, "Butterfly Kisses" by Bob Carlisle, or "What a Wonderful World" by Louis Armstrong. The dance is often kept simple, with just the pair on the dance floor, though some opt for group participation later. If the father is unavailable, a stepfather, grandfather, or another significant male figure may take his place. This tradition emphasizes family bonds and can be customized to reflect personal stories or cultural nuances within English traditions.
